Swansea Sound - Swansea Sound (Cymraeg)
Play more Swansea SoundThe Vinyl DistrictFollow “Genius all too often goes unrecognized—when was the last time you saw someone wearing a Foghat t-shirt? Such is the…” on Aug 4th, 2023 →
Once a week, Stack delivers a mix of the most interesting new music on the web, handpicked by the Hype Machine team. Here's a recent mix.